Abstract

With the comprehensive popularization of generative artificial intelligence represented by Midjourney and Stable Diffusion in the design industry, AI has become an indispensable auxiliary tool for designers in conceptual sketching, scheme iteration, material rendering and visual output. However, the dual contradictions of AI stimulating creative inspiration and triggering design homogenization have become prominent pain points in the current design industry. Existing research mostly focuses on the final design output of AI-assisted creation, while ignoring the dynamic changes of designers’ whole creative process under human-machine collaborative working mode, lacking systematic research on the internal mechanism of creativity gain and loss. Taking graphic design, environmental design and product design practitioners as research objects, this paper takes generative AI tools as the core auxiliary carrier, defines the connotation and classification of "human-machine collaboration modes" in design work, and constructs a whole-process analysis framework of "pre-creation inspiration—mid-process scheme iteration—post-production optimization evaluation". This research reveals the positive driving and negative restriction mechanism of AI on designers’ creative thinking, solves the problem of creative homogenization caused by over-reliance on AI, provides theoretical reference for standardized human-machine collaborative design workflow, and forms a replicable practical paradigm for designers to give full play to independent creative ability under AI auxiliary environment.
